The Salt Method: One Researcher Directs an AI Agent Fleet From App Code to RISC-V Tape-Out With Zero Human-Reviewed RTL

In five weeks on consumer AI subscriptions, one researcher directed an agent fleet from application code through a verified compiler to a RISC-V tape-out on a community silicon shuttle, with no human reviewing a single proof and no human writing a single line of RTL.

The constraint being removed here is not RTL authorship. It is RTL authorship as the rate-limiting step between a software-described specification and a physical chip. Jason Hickey published a 17-page accounting of the Salt method: one researcher, five weeks, consumer AI subscriptions, AI agents directed from application code through a verified Lean 4 compiler and executive to a RISC-V processor taped out on a community silicon shuttle. No proof passed human review. No RTL was human-written. The error ledger ran to catch #256 against zero incorrect proofs reaching the record.

The mechanism is a proof kernel that functions as the incorruptible handoff point between agents. Mathematical claims travel as kernel-checked artifacts, not prose. Human attention is reserved for statements, designs, and rulings. SAT-checked equivalence closes the gap at the silicon boundary. The agents do the mechanical work; the kernel is what makes scale possible without compounding hallucination errors. The result is a verified compiler-to-silicon chain where the human is the architect, not the implementor.

The consensus read on this kind of result is "interesting research, not ready for production." That read is probably wrong on the timeline people expect. The Salt method did not produce a production chip. It produced evidence that the bottleneck in silicon realization can be relocated from RTL authorship to specification clarity, because a Lean 4 kernel can check what an army of agents cannot.
